I am making some slow progress on the topic of Tom Reiser’s 32V with virtual memory.

Two more names popped up of folks who worked with his virtual memory code base at Bell Labs / USG in the early 80’s: Robert (Bob) Baron and Jim McCormick. Bob Barron was later working on Mach at CMU.
